Short-term drug rehab and alcohol treatment services in Porter, Oklahoma are usually delivered in a residential or inpatient setting for a period of 30 days or less. Though long term drug rehab typically demands at least a 90 day stay and a lot more rigorous course of treatment, short-term drug rehab and alcohol treatment services work by getting the addicted person abstinent through detox followed by a short course of therapy and counseling to lightly deal with emotional addiction issues. Because it usually takes several weeks if not months to completely address all issues which may bring about relapse once they go back into the real world, short-term drug rehab and alcohol treatment services may not be adequate for those in Porter, Oklahoma who have a long termaddiction and/or dependence to drugs.
